Around the Bend 7 x 5 Inspirational Card with Video Tutorial

Welcome to my Corner of the World

I don’t usually make big cards, partly because of the extra postage we have to pay here in the US. So I have always stuck to making them with 1/2 sheet of 11 x 8 1/2 card with the finished card size of 5 1/2 x 4 1/4. Then I received a card from a friend – it was bigger than 5 1/2 x 4 1/4 but still had the regular first class stamp. So I did a little research and found that I could send a max size of 7 x 5 for the same first class stamp – so today’s card is just that size!!
